Who is the Female Titan in AOT?

4 Answers2026-02-10 05:14:21
The Female Titan in 'Attack on Titan' is one of those characters that immediately grabs your attention with her sheer power and mystery. I still get chills thinking about her first appearance—this towering, agile figure moving with almost eerie grace through the battlefield. It’s later revealed that she’s Annie Leonhart, a former cadet from the 104th Training Corps. What’s fascinating about Annie is how layered she is. On the surface, she’s this stoic, detached warrior, but there’s so much more beneath that. Her combat skills are insane, especially her hand-to-hand fighting style, which stands out in a world dominated by swords and Titans. What really got me hooked was her backstory and motivations. She’s not just a villain; she’s someone trapped in a mission she didn’t entirely choose, with her own fears and regrets. The way she cries inside the Titan’s nape during the Stohess District arc hit me hard. It’s moments like these that make 'AOT' so compelling—characters aren’t black and white, and Annie’s no exception. Even now, I’m curious about how her story will unfold in the final arcs.

What are the powers of the Female Titan in AOT?

4 Answers2026-02-10 14:51:29
The Female Titan in 'Attack on Titan' is such a fascinating subject! What stands out most to me is her unique ability to harden specific body parts, almost like crystallizing them—something other Titans can't do as precisely. This makes her both a defensive powerhouse and a terrifying opponent in close combat. Remember how she blocked attacks from Levi's squad by hardening her nape? Brutal. Another underrated aspect is her endurance. Unlike some shifters who burn out fast, she can maintain her form for extended periods, likely due to Annie's disciplined training. Plus, her scream attracts nearby Titans, turning the battlefield into chaos. It’s like she weaponizes the environment itself. Honestly, I’d love to see more exploration of how her martial arts background synergizes with these abilities—those fight scenes were choreographed beautifully.

How does the Female Titan impact the AOT story?

4 Answers2026-02-10 16:44:28
The Female Titan isn't just another mindless monster in 'Attack on Titan'—she's a turning point that reshapes everything. Before her appearance, the Scouts were dealing with pure Titans, but Annie's transformation flipped the script. Suddenly, humanity realized they weren't just fighting beasts; they were up against intelligent, strategic foes who could blend in among them. The Stohess District chase? Pure chaos. That scene exposed how vulnerable the walls truly were, not just to Titans but to betrayal from within. What fascinates me is how Annie’s role forced Eren to question his own rage. Here’s this Titan, clearly human, yet so ruthless. It messed with his black-and-white view of good vs. evil. And let’s not forget the emotional gut punch when Mikasa realizes Annie’s identity—her frozen hesitation says more about loyalty and trauma than any monologue could. The Female Titan arc didn’t just advance the plot; it dug deep into the characters’ psyches.
